Investigation on the stability of the Rijke-type thermoacoustic system with an axially distributed heat source
Due to the incurred damages to the combustors, large-amplitude self-sustained thermoacoustic oscillations are unwanted in many propulsion systems, such as liquid/solid rocket motors and aero-engines.
